Couscous Bowl with Grilled Vegetables

Couscous is made from vegetable stock and served with grilled zucchini, bell peppers, chickpeas and lemon tahini sauce. Loosen couscous with a fork after soaking and add vegetables and sauce in portions only afterwards. Bulgur can replace couscous, roasted almonds complement the bowl with crispness.

Method

  1. 1

    Prepare ingredients

    Courgettes: dice. Peppers: dice. Chickpeas: drain. Lemon: squeeze out.

  2. 2

    Prepare

    Couscous is swollen in vegetable broth and served with grilled zucchini, bell peppers, chickpeas and lemon tahini sauce.

  3. 3

    Check for doneness

    Loosen couscous with a fork after soaking and add vegetables and sauce in portions only afterwards.

  4. 4

    Serve

    Loosen the couscous in bowls and spread the still warm grilled vegetables on top. Finally, add the tahini-lemon dressing and parsley to keep the individual ingredients recognisable.
